Why Couples Choose Marriage Counseling and Couples Therapy

Couples seek therapy for many reasons. Some are dealing with ongoing conflict, while others feel emotionally disconnected or stuck in unhealthy communication patterns. Counseling isn’t only for relationships in crisis-it’s also for couples who want to strengthen their bond and grow together.

Common reasons couples explore Long Island marriage counseling and couples therapy include:

  • Repeated arguments with no resolution
  • Difficulty communicating needs or emotions
  • Emotional distance or loss of intimacy
  • Stress related to work, parenting, or finances
  • Navigating major life transitions

Therapy helps couples slow down and focus on the relationship itself.

What Happens During Counseling Sessions

Many couples worry about what therapy sessions will actually look like. At The Prism Practice, sessions are conversational and collaborative rather than rigid or clinical. Both partners are encouraged to share their perspectives in a respectful, structured setting.

Marriage counseling and couples therapy often focus on:

  • Identifying communication patterns
  • Understanding emotional triggers
  • Exploring unmet needs
  • Strengthening trust and emotional safety
  • Learning healthier ways to manage conflict

The goal is understanding-not assigning blame.

How Therapy Improves Communication and Connection

One of the most valuable outcomes of couples therapy is improved communication. Many couples discover that they’ve been talking but not truly listening. Counseling helps partners hear each other with more empathy and less defensiveness.

Through therapy, couples learn how to:

  • Express feelings clearly and calmly
  • Listen without interrupting or reacting
  • Address conflict before it escalates
  • Rebuild emotional closeness

These skills often lead to stronger connection both inside and outside of sessions.
